Why This Series Exists

In 2018, my husband was diagnosed with pancreatic cancer. What followed was four years of loss stacking on loss. By October 2022, I realized I was in trouble. I couldn’t move. Not tired. Not grieving. Frozen.

A desperate prayer opened a healing cycle that made me see what I hadn’t wanted to look at. And it led me to a question: Where do I end and another begins?

I started with myself. I noticed my nervous system wasn’t calm—it was stuck. And I noticed something else: shadows live in activation. We need to be activated to see them. But we’re told to calm down.

Is it possible to do both?

I found out it is. It’s not about choosing a state. It’s about fluidity—the capacity to move between states consciously. To stay present at the edges where things meet.

And that’s when I saw it: the nervous system is the key that fits every intersection. Between your own states. Between shadow and wisdom. Between you and others. Between you and life itself.

Some of us have difficult curriculum. But to each of us, our edge feels like THE edge—because it is. It’s calibrated to walk us right up to the limit of what we know how to hold.

I’ve been walked to mine. And I found a way through.

These books are that way.

About the Author

Sheila Rumble, author of The Intersection of You and Me

Sheila Rumble

Sheila learned to hold space through devastating necessity—widowed at 44 with four kids, followed by years of compounding loss that required building capacity she didn’t know was possible.

She teaches what she had to learn the hard way: the foundation, mechanics, and practice of genuine presence in relationships. Not because it sounded nice, but because survival demanded it.

Through Rowan Wellness, she offers QHHT (Quantum Healing Hypnosis Technique), somatic breathwork, energy healing, and spiritual coaching—all rooted in the same principles this series explores.
